Project Engineer – Water & Wastewater (Contract)
Location: Redditch (Hybrid – 3 days on-site, 2 days remote)
Duration: 5 months
Outside IR35 | 47.5 hours per week
We’re partnering with a leading consultancy on an AMP8 Capital Delivery Programme, supporting their search for 2 experienced Project Engineers to assist across water and wastewater treatment schemes throughout the West Midlands.
This is a contract-only, short-term requirement, ideal for technically strong engineers with a MEICA background and proven delivery within regulated environments.
The Role
Working alongside Project Managers and MEICA Managers, you’ll play a key role in technical assurance, design review, procurement coordination, and readiness for commissioning. You’ll ensure supplier inputs and documentation are fully integrated into the wider project design and support smooth transition into construction phases.
Key Responsibilities
Support MEICA design activities across allocated projects
Review and coordinate design documentation and supplier integration
Assist in developing specifications to enable procurement
Monitor and review Schedules, Specifications, P&IDs, Equipment Lists, Control Philosophies and FDS
Liaise across design, procurement, and commissioning teams to ensure readiness and technical compliance
Engage in sub-contractor scoping, coordination, and off-site manufacturing oversight
Support technical governance and ensure commissioning needs are factored in early
What You’ll Bring
HNC or Apprenticeship in a relevant MEICA discipline
Minimum 4 years' experience within the water sector or similarly regulated environments
Strong technical writing and communication skills
Ability to interpret and challenge technical design content
Comfortable working across Office 365 and collaborating with multiple teams
